How to fill out the MA DoR 1-NR/PY online

The MA DoR 1-NR/PY form is essential for individuals who are nonresidents or part-year residents of Massachusetts. This guide provides a step-by-step approach to successfully completing this form online, ensuring you understand each component.

Follow the steps to fill out the MA DoR 1-NR/PY form online.

  1.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the MA DoR 1-NR/PY form and open it in your preferred online editor.
  2. Provide your first name, middle initial, and last name in the designated fields. If married, include your spouse’s name as well.
  3. Enter your Social Security number and that of your spouse if applicable.
  4. Fill in your current address, including city, state, and ZIP code, along with the address of legal residence or domicile if filing as a nonresident.
  5. Complete the section regarding your filing status by selecting the appropriate option, such as single, married filing jointly, or head of household.
  6. For part-year residents, indicate the dates you lived in Massachusetts. Calculate and input the total days spent in the state.
  7. Report your total income from various sources. Use the appropriate lines for wages, pensions, and other income, following the instructions carefully.
  8. Fill out the exemptions section according to your filing status and number of dependents. Ensure you calculate the total correctly.
  9. Enter applicable deductions, ensuring they relate to your Massachusetts income reported on this return, and add them up.
  10. Calculate your total income tax and apply any credits you may qualify for from associated schedules.
  11. Finally, review all entries for accuracy, save any changes made, and you can then download, print, or share your completed form as required.

Individuals who earn income in Massachusetts or are residents of the state are required to file a Massachusetts state tax return. Nonresidents must file if they earn income sourced in Massachusetts. Additionally, residents earning above certain thresholds, regardless of the source, must also file returns. Using the MA DoR 1-NR/PY ensures that your nonresident income is reported properly to avoid complications.

A nonresident is required to file an income tax return if they have Massachusetts-source income. This includes wages, rental income, and any income generated from investments in the state. You must file your MA Form 1 NR with the Massachusetts Department of Revenue. You can submit it either by mail or electronically, depending on your preference and circumstances. Electronic filing is often faster and may provide you with quicker confirmations. Using the MA DoR 1-NR/PY helps to streamline your submission and ensures accurate processing.
